Oddibe McDowell

Oddibe McDowell Notable

b. August 25, 1962 · Texas Rangers 1985–1988, 1994, Cleveland Indians 1989, Atlanta Braves 1989–1990

Oddibe McDowell played for three clubs across 10 seasons as a center fielder, opening with the Texas Rangers in 1985 and closing with the Texas Rangers in 1994.

Across 830 games he batted .253, with 715 hits and 458 runs. He finished with 74 home runs, 125 doubles and 169 stolen bases.

He played 746 games in the outfield, with 1,687 putouts and 22 errors.

He hit for the cycle in 1985.

He was born in Hollywood, FL, USA on August 25, 1962. He batted left-handed and threw left-handed.
